So I pretty much devoured this one, it was so fun!

Julian and Dahlia are adorable, and I love how they antagonized each other the whole time. It's a hard line to walk (as someone who antagonizes people daily for fun) between playful snarky and just plain obnoxious and while I don't always do it well, they sure did.

I also loved that their moms were best friends and both families were essentially one. I think the only thing that I didn't quite buy was that Julian is a billionaire - like, sure, you can tell he has money, and that he's conflicted about spending it because he didn't grow up with it, but also idk how a tech company that small could make that much? 

I don't know a ton about real estate as a field, but I do know that it's hard to get a tech company worth that much with that little staff. Like apparently it was only his cousin that built it? And there's no mention of a dev team or support team that manages it? Maybe because Julian is on the other side of things, and we'll get that with Rafa's book (spoiler, Rafa is for sure getting his own but you can guess that about 30 pages in) but I simply Do Not Think that's right.
